Daniel P. Jackson is a Shareholder and a member of Vedder Price’s Commercial Litigation and Creditors’ Rights and Collections groups.

Mr. Jackson focuses his practice on representing both traditional and nontraditional financial institutions, equipment lessors and manufacturers in litigation matters throughout the United States. He has significant experience enforcing commercial lending/leasing agreements, defending tort claims and litigating matters involving the transportation industry.

Creditors’ Rights and Collection

Mr. Jackson also concentrates his practice in the representation of lenders, large equipment lessors and other creditors in state, district and appellate courts, including prosecuting numerous breach-of-contract and replevin actions as well as post-judgment enforcement and collection, and representing the interests of secured and unsecured creditors in various state courts.

Strategic Defense of Consumer Finance and Related Class Actions

In addition, Mr. Jackson has experience defending companies in consumer litigation matters, including class actions and claims under the Telephone Consumer Protection Act, the Fair Credit Reporting Act, the Fair Debt Collection Practices Act and other federal and state statutory claims. Mr. Jackson counsels clients on litigation avoidance and works diligently with clients in the consumer finance space to develop a strategic, cost-effective approaches to achieving success.

Transportation Litigation

Mr. Jackson has experience in all aspects of litigation, appeals and post-judgment proceedings, including arbitrations and bench and jury trials. As a result of his litigation experience and collaboration with members of the firm’s Global Transportation Finance practice team, Mr. Jackson understands that transportation clients deserve litigation counsel who takes time to understand their business operations and objectives.

Real Estate Litigation

Mr. Jackson also has experience with real estate litigation, and he collaborates closely with the firm’s Real Estate practice group. Mr. Jackson is experienced in a variety of real estate litigation matters including commercial lease disputes.

Consumer and Commercial Arbitrations

Mr. Jackson regularly works with clients to strengthen and improve upon their arbitration agreements in the consumer and commercial context. Mr. Jackson also frequently counsels clients on arbitration enforcement inquiries and has successfully helped clients enforce these arbitration agreements in litigation matters throughout the United States.
